For example, 24/60 can be divided by 2 to get 12/30, which can be further divided by 2 to get 6/15, which can then be divided by 3 to get 2/5. 2/5 can no longer be divided by the same number without remainder. ...

How to Divide by 0.5. A quick way to divide by 0.5 or Β½ is to double the number (or multiply the number by 2). The reason for this is that two halves go into a whole.
